Full job description
Position contingent upon Contract Award
As the PMO Analyst you will be responsible for project documentation, process analysis, and workflow optimization to support critical government and intelligence initiatives.
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:
Maintain and organize project documentation and ensure version control
Conduct business process analyses to support workflow optimization
Develop, manage, and standardize project templates and process frameworks
Track deliverables and monitor adherence to project timelines and milestones
Ensure compliance with project management methodologies, including Agile and Waterfall
Support accurate and timely project reporting to leadership and stakeholders
Collaborate with PMs and teams to improve efficiency, transparency, and accountability
EDUCATION & EXPERIENCE:
High school diploma/GED with 8 years, associates with 6 years, bachelor's with 4 years, or master's with 2 years of relevant experience
KNOWLEDGE & SKILLS:
Experience supporting project management offices (PMOs) or large-scale programs
Proficiency with Agile, Waterfall, or hybrid methodologies
Strong analytical skills and a structured approach to process improvement
Familiarity with project management tools such as MS Project, JIRA, or ServiceNow
Excellent communication, organizational, and documentation skills
